Attractive in design and
built from enduring Redwood
THESE modern homes in the beautiful Country Club District of
Kansas City are designed for comfort and pleasing appearance. They are built of the most enduring wood.
Redwood was selected for the exterior for several reasons.
Redwood is not subject to any form of decay. A natural, odorless preservative permeates every fibre of Redwood during the growth of the tree and protects it against fungus diseases and against boring worms and insects. Seasoning does not destroy this preservative. Exposed to the weather or in contact with soil moisture, Redwood remains sound indefinitely.
Its uniform cell structure gives Redwood a firm, even texture that assures excellent working qualities and provides surfaces which take and hold paint unusually well.
Redwood’s freedom from resinous compounds reduces the fire hazard wherever used.
Redwood lumber and millwork can be bought at prices little higher than for wood which cannot compare with Redwood in rot-resistance, proportion of clear lumber, uniform texture or freedom from shrinking, warping or swelling.

Redwood should be specified for
Exterior Construction including — Colonial siding, clapboards, shingles, door and window frames — gutters, eaves, water tables and mudsills — porch rail, balusters and columns — mouldings and lattice. Pickets and fencing — Pergolas and Greenhouses.
Interior Finish Natural, stained or painted Wood block floors.
Industrial Uses Tanks and Vats for water chemicals and oil. Factory roofs and gutters — Wood block flooring.
Wood Specialties
Such as — Caskets and burial boxes — Incubators and ice cream cabinets and Cigar and candy boxes, etc.
Railroad Uses Such as — Railroad ties and tunnel timbers — Signal wire conduits and water tanks — Car siding and roofing.
Farm and Dairy Uses Such as — Silos, tanks and troughs — Hog feeders and implement sheds — Wood block floors, etc.
